For the 2025 school year, there are 2 public middle schools serving 34 students in Minnesota Valley Education School District. This district's average middle testing ranking is 3/10, which is in the bottom 50% of public middle schools in Minnesota.
Public Middle Schools in Minnesota Valley Education School District have an average math proficiency score of 27% (versus the Minnesota public middle school average of 40%), and reading proficiency score of 28% (versus the 49% statewide average).
Minority enrollment is 32%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Minnesota public middle school average of 38% (majority Black and Hispanic).
